System requirements

  • A working self-hosted WordPress website
  • An administrator account with permission to install plugins
  • HTTPS is strongly recommended for customer and licence security
  • A valid licence for protected updates and commercial use
01

Install RaffleFlow

  1. Download the RaffleFlow ZIP from your customer account.
  2. In WordPress, open Plugins → Add New Plugin → Upload Plugin.
  3. Select the ZIP file. Do not unzip it first.
  4. Choose Install Now, then Activate Plugin.
  5. Open RaffleFlow from the WordPress administration menu.
Updating manually? Upload the newer ZIP and choose Replace current with uploaded. Your campaigns and entries remain in the database.
02

Activate your licence

  1. Copy the licence key from your purchase email or customer account.
  2. Open the RaffleFlow licence screen in WordPress.
  3. Paste the key and select Activate.
  4. Confirm that the screen shows an active licence and the correct plan.

Licence server details are built into the product. Customers should never need to enter or change the licensing server address.

03

Create your first campaign

  1. Open the Setup Wizard or select RaffleFlow → Campaigns → Add New.
  2. Choose a blank campaign or one of the campaign templates.
  3. Add the campaign name, dates, rules, prizes and visual branding.
  4. Configure entry access, consent text and draw settings.
  5. Save the campaign and preview it before accepting entries.
04

Publish the campaign

Use the native Gutenberg blocks for the cleanest setup. Add a new WordPress page, select the required RaffleFlow block and choose the campaign in the block settings.

Prize Wheel · My Entries · Draw Records

Legacy shortcodes remain available for existing pages. Test the page while logged out before sharing it publicly.

Safe updates

Use the normal WordPress Updates screen. Keep the licence active so WordPress can retrieve the protected package. Back up the database before major updates and never remove plugin data tables during a normal update.

Common issues

The licence will not activate

Confirm the key was copied without spaces, the site uses HTTPS, and outbound HTTPS requests are allowed by the host. If the activation limit was reached after moving domains, contact support.

The wheel shows no entries

Confirm the correct campaign is selected, the campaign is active, and its entry dates allow submissions. Clear page and optimisation caches after changing settings.

The update is not visible

Check the licence is active, then open WordPress Updates and select Check again. If it remains unavailable, include the installed version and System Health details in your support request.

Alpha release. Install on a staging or development website first. Take a complete site and database backup before every update.

System requirements

  • WordPress 6.4 or newer
  • PHP 8.2 or newer
  • HTTPS for licensing, secure accounts, uploads and developer webhooks
  • Enough storage and upload capacity for the community media you allow
  • A staging environment for testing alpha updates
01

Install SMitov Social

  1. Create a complete backup or staging copy of the website.
  2. Download the plugin ZIP from your customer account.
  3. Open Plugins → Add New Plugin → Upload Plugin.
  4. Upload the ZIP, install it and activate SMitov Social.
  5. Allow the initial database migrations and page setup to complete.
02

Activate the licence

  1. Open the SMitov Social control centre and select the licence area.
  2. Paste the licence key supplied with your purchase.
  3. Choose Activate and confirm the site is connected.

The trusted update and licensing connection is preconfigured. Do not add third-party licence endpoints or expose licence keys in screenshots.

03

Complete the initial setup

  1. Review platform identity, registration and access settings.
  2. Set community privacy, moderation and media limits.
  3. Choose Light, Dark or Automatic frontend appearance.
  4. Check email delivery and notification preferences.
  5. Create two test accounts and verify registration, profiles, posting and privacy before launch.
04

Community pages and blocks

SMitov Social uses native dynamic Gutenberg blocks and can create its core pages automatically. These include the social home, activity feed, member directory, current-user profile, access portal, notifications, groups, privacy centre and discovery.

Do not delete automatically created pages while their blocks are in use. When changing a site theme, test navigation, headers and community page widths on staging first.

Security and privacy checks

  • Review Security diagnostics after installation
  • Keep REST and AJAX rate limiting enabled
  • Configure privacy retention and personal-data tools
  • Use supported file types and conservative media limits
  • Never disable same-origin protection to work around a theme or caching issue

Update and recovery

SMitov Social validates protected update packages and includes recovery checks, but a current external backup is still required. Test updates on staging, verify database migrations, then check the feed, uploads, messaging, groups, notifications, discovery and privacy controls before updating production.

Need help? Send the installed version, WordPress and PHP versions, the exact error, and a screenshot. Never send passwords, payment details or private licence keys.
